Products For Gutter Service in useMaintaining clean and functional gutters is an essential part of home upkeep, especially in areas like Hagerstown, MD where seasonal changes can lead to debris accumulation. Effective gutter service involves a variety of tools and products designed to facilitate cleaning, inspection, and maintenance tasks. From simple handheld scoops to advanced telescoping tools, there are options suitable for homeowners and professionals alike. Proper gutter management can help prevent water damage, foundation issues, and landscape erosion by ensuring that water flows freely through the system.

Types of Products For Gutter Service

Gutter Cleaning Scoops

Handheld scoops designed to remove debris from gutters quickly and easily.

Telescoping Gutter Cleaners

Extendable tools that allow reaching high gutters without a ladder.

Gutter Guards

Protective covers that prevent debris from entering gutters, reducing cleaning frequency.

Gutter Maintenance Kits

Comprehensive sets including brushes, scoops, and attachments for thorough cleaning.

Pressure Washer Attachments

Specialized nozzles and brushes for cleaning gutters with high-pressure water.

Gutter Inspection Cameras

Small cameras that help inspect gutters for damage or blockages from the ground.

Downspout Augers

Tools designed to clear blockages within downspouts effectively.

Gutter Repair Kits

Repair patches, sealants, and fasteners for fixing leaks and damage.

Ladder Accessories

Safety harnesses, stabilizers, and hooks to enhance ladder stability during gutter work.

Gutter Debris Containers

Portable containers to collect and transport debris during cleaning.

Choosing the right products for gutter service depends on several factors including the size of the property, the type of gutters installed, and personal preferences for ease of use. Regular inspections and timely cleaning can extend the lifespan of gutters and downspouts, reducing the need for costly repairs down the line. Many products are designed to make gutter maintenance safer and more efficient, allowing users to reach high or difficult areas without the need for ladders or scaffolding.

In addition to cleaning tools, there are accessories and protective solutions that can help minimize debris buildup and simplify ongoing maintenance. Gutter guards, for example, are popular options that prevent leaves and twigs from entering the system, thereby reducing the frequency of cleaning. For those looking for a more comprehensive approach, combining various tools and accessories can ensure thorough maintenance and better water management throughout the year. Key Buying Considerations

  • Gutter type and size: Ensure the product is compatible with your gutter dimensions and materials.
  • Reach and extension: Consider how high your gutters are and whether an extendable tool is needed.
  • Ease of use: Look for ergonomic designs that reduce strain and improve handling.
  • Safety features: Opt for tools with safety features, especially if working from the ground or on ladders.
  • Durability and materials: Choose products made from weather-resistant and sturdy materials for long-term use.
  • Compatibility with existing tools: Check if accessories or attachments work with your current equipment.
  • Maintenance and cleaning: Consider how easy it is to clean and maintain the product itself.
  • Storage and portability: Compact and lightweight tools are easier to store and transport.
  • Versatility: Multi-functional tools can handle different tasks such as cleaning, inspecting, and repairing.
  • Cost and value: Balance the features and quality with your budget to find a suitable option.
  • Customer reviews: Read feedback to gauge real-world performance and reliability.
  • Availability of replacement parts: Ensure that parts like brushes or blades can be replaced if needed.
  • Compatibility with power sources: For powered tools, verify battery life or corded options.
  • Environmental conditions: Consider products that perform well in your local climate and weather patterns.
  • Professional vs. DIY use: Choose tools that match your experience level and maintenance frequency.
